I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Composants graphiques Android Discussion :

Problème de Layout


Sujet :

Composants graphiques Android

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Inscrit en
    Avril 2005
    Messages
    156
    Détails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 156
    Par défaut Problème de Layout
    Bonjour a tous,

    J'ai un probleme a mon avis simple, mais que je n'arrive pas a resoudre : je souhaite creer un layout XML dont la structure est la suivante :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
     
    -------------------------
    |                 |     |
    |                 |  2  |
    |                 | _ _ |
    |        1        |     |
    |                 |  3  |
    |                 |     |
    -------------------------
    L'element 1 est une ListeView, les elements 2 et 3 sont des Button. Comment faire ?
    Merci...

  2. #2
    Expert confirmé

    Avatar de Feanorin
    Profil pro
    Inscrit en
    Avril 2004
    Messages
    4 589
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2004
    Messages : 4 589
    Par défaut
    Tu as plusieurs façon de faire .

    Soit tu passe par un linear qui représentera ton cadre en orientation verticale.

    Dans celui ci tu crée ta listview et suite à celle ci une nouvelle linear qui elle sera d'orientation horizontale (avec les deux bouton inclus dans celle ci )

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
     
    Linear 1 vertical 
    -------------------------
    |             Linear 2 horizontal
    |                 |     |
    |                 |  2  |
    |                 | _ _ |
    |ListView         |     |
    |                 |  3  |
    |                 |     |
    -------------------------
    Ou passer par un RelativeLayout
    http://developer.android.com/referen...iveLayout.html

  3. #3
    Membre confirmé
    Inscrit en
    Avril 2005
    Messages
    156
    Détails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 156
    Par défaut
    Merci, je m'etais deja oriente vers ces deux pistes, mais je n'arrive pas a :
    - placer les 2 boutons l'un au-dessus de l'autre, chacun se repartissant la hauteur du layout parent ;
    - faire en sorte que la liste occupe tout l'espace restant (si je mets layout_width="fill_parent", les boutons ne sont plus visibles)...

  4. #4
    Expert confirmé

    Avatar de Feanorin
    Profil pro
    Inscrit en
    Avril 2004
    Messages
    4 589
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2004
    Messages : 4 589
    Par défaut
    Bonjour,


    Pour la solution avec le linearlayout , tu peux utiliser l'argument layout_weight = 1 , pour la liste View ainsi que pour le second linear , comme cela ca marche
    avec la largeur en fill_parent .

    De même pour les boutons dans le second linear avec la hauteur en fill_parent.

  5. #5
    Membre confirmé
    Inscrit en
    Avril 2005
    Messages
    156
    Détails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 156
    Par défaut
    Super, merci beaucoup Feanorin !

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[Struts-Layout] problème avec layout:datagrid
    Par khayri dans le forum Struts 1
    Réponses: 2
    Dernier message: 20/04/2007, 09h31
  2. Problème de Layout
    Par jason69 dans le forum AWT/Swing
    Réponses: 11
    Dernier message: 30/08/2006, 15h45
  3. [SashForm]Problème de layout
    Par Efkar dans le forum SWT/JFace
    Réponses: 3
    Dernier message: 18/08/2006, 13h28
  4. Problème de layout
    Par menuge dans le forum AWT/Swing
    Réponses: 2
    Dernier message: 10/05/2006, 16h47
  5. [JscrollPane]Problèmes avec layout du panel intérieur
    Par Baptiste Wicht dans le forum AWT/Swing
    Réponses: 14
    Dernier message: 19/03/2006, 13h08

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o